Product Description

This is the ultimate film portrait of the life and work of one of the greatest artists of the 20th Century. This powerful independent retrospective draws on rare footage of John Lennon in performance with the Beatles and in his solo career, which is reviewed and reassessed by those who knew and worked with him.

John performs with interuptions3
I purchased this video in hopes of seeing classic live performances by John winston ono Lennon. I had hoped to see them uninteruped. However every clip that was shown, was interupted by various coherts from the past who infringed upon the so called performaces with their opinions. I feel the poterntial purchaser should know what is in store for him, should he/she elect to buy this DVD. I wish I could gather together video performaces from John's all too short career in music. As is, what you get is a lot recollectins, yet not enough live performaces.

leader of the Beatles3
I have some interest in songwriters, so I found this DVD interesting on how the songs of John Lennon matured during the years he was in the Beatles, making a few movies, and exposed to Bob Dylan and drugs. Heroin makes a good explanation for the break up of the Beatles, as John Lennon became reluctant to take part in anything that did not get him off in a major high. Something about John Lennon being shot still tells me more than this DVD was willing to try for.
